Full comparison
| Metric | PU Prime | VT Markets |
|---|---|---|
| Clarity Score | 75 | 80 |
| Risk level | Higher risk | Higher risk |
| Regulators | SCB, FSCA | ASIC, FSCA, FSC |
| Segregated funds | Yes | Yes |
| All-in cost | $$··· | $$··· |
| Min deposit | $50 | $100 |
| Typical spread (EUR/USD) | 0 pips | 0 pips |
| Max leverage (intl.) | 1000:1 | 500:1 |
| Withdrawal speed | Same – next day | Same – next day |
| Demo account | Yes | Yes |
| Copy trading | Yes | Yes |
| Platforms | MT4, MT5, Proprietary, Web, iOS, Android | MT4, MT5, Proprietary, Web, iOS, Android |
